הַסּוֹמֵךְ סֻכָּתוֹ בְּכַרְעֵי הַמִּטָּה, כְּשֵׁרָה.

  • One who supports his Sukkah on the legs of a bed, (has made) a kosher Sukkah

  • What would this case even look like?

5

Slide image

6

רַבִּי יְהוּדָה אוֹמֵר, אִם אֵינָהּ יְכוֹלָה לַעֲמֹד בִּפְנֵי עַצְמָהּ, פְּסוּלָה

Rabbi Yehuda says that if it (the Sukkah) cannot stand without the bed, it is NOT kosher.

סֻכָּה הַמְדֻבְלֶלֶת

  • A disorderly sukkah

  • This is a sukkah that has סכך on different levels.

  • What does that look like?

13

Slide image

Do you see how the pieces are placed one higher up followed by one lower down?

14

וְשֶׁצִּלָּתָהּ מְרֻבָּה מֵחַמָּתָהּ, כְּשֵׁרָה

  • Or a sukkah that has more shade than sunlight...

  • Both the disorderly sukkah and this one are כשרים.

הַמְעֻבָּה כְמִין בַּיִת, אַף עַל פִּי שֶׁאֵין הַכּוֹכָבִים נִרְאִים מִתּוֹכָהּ, כְּשֵׁרָה

  • A thick סכך sukkah, so thick that it is almost as though you are inside a house, is kosher EVEN if you can't see the stars.

  • Wait! I thought you have to be able to see the stars through the סכך?!?!

18

You should be able to see the stars through the סכך, but if you can't the sukkah is still kosher.
